Bitcoin Wallets Holding $1 Million or More Surge 237% in 2023

  • Anticipation of forthcoming spot ETF products has boosted the price of most cryptocurrencies.
  • The number of addresses holding more than $1 million in BTC has climbed to 81,925.

This year, the number of cryptocurrency wallet addresses with over $1 million in Bitcoin has increased by more than a factor of three. According to statistics compiled by BitInfoCharts, the number of addresses holding more than $1 million in BTC has climbed from 23,795 on January 1 to 81,925 at now, a growth rate of 237%.

Many of the addresses holding more than a million in BTC are associated with cryptocurrency exchanges and financial organizations rather than users as individuals.

The number of addresses holding more than $1 million in Bitcoin reached its all-time high on November 9, 2021, one day before Bitcoin reached its ATH of $69k on November 10, 2021, according to statistics compiled by Glassnode.

Meanwhile, there has been a modest rise in the number of “wholecoiners” (wallets holding at least 1 BTC) since the start of the year. The number of such addresses has increased to 1,018,015 from 978,197 on January 1.

Between April and December of last year, wholecoins increased by the most since the beginning of 2018, indicating a robust accumulation tendency despite a larger price fall caused by a number of significant collapses in the sector.

All Eyes on Spot Bitcoin ETF Approval

The current price of Bitcoin is close to $37,000, an increase of 38.64 percent in the last 30 days. Investor’s anticipation of many forthcoming spot ETF products has boosted the price of most cryptocurrencies.

Many investors anticipate a large price increase after Bloomberg ETF experts estimate there is a 90% probability a spot Bitcoin ETF will be approved by January 10. Despite the market’s optimism, not all experts believe that the approval of a spot Bitcoin ETF would spark the next bull run.
